sql的出口函数

甲骨文的出口函数
,,,,,,选择t.fene
,,,,,,,,,,,,,,,,,从fenebiao t
,,,,,,,,,,,,,,,,在t。代码=& # 39;001 & # 39;和日期=to_date (& # 39; 2017 - 07 - 17 & # 39;, & # 39; yyyy-mm-dd& # 39;)
,,,,,,,,,,和存在(选择1得到;cszqxx b
,,,,,,,,,,,,where b。fzqdm=substr (t。fkmbm 9 6)
,,,,,,,,,和b。fscdm=& # 39; 100253 & # 39;)

分析:从fenebiao中可以查到关于001年基金的所有债券的fene(份额)信息,现在要查询出100253的债券的份额信息;但是fenebiao中没有fscdm字段,该字段存在于cszqxx表中,cszqxx表于fenebiao的对应关系b。fzqdm=substr (t。fkmbm 9 6);之前用的是左连接,关于& # 39;100253 & # 39;cszqxx表中有两条信息,这样就会查询两个fene。用出口是根据出口函数内的返回值,过滤主表fenebiao的内容。

另外,以下内容来自百度知道:

表(小表),表B(大表)
select *从B在cc(从一个选择cc)这个语句中是先从一个表中把cc找出来,然后根据cc再在B中去找相关的cc由于一个表的cc远小于B表的cc所以可以节省时间
select *从B存在(从哪里选择cc cc=B.cc)这句话是先从B表里把cc找出来然后再在一个表里找相关的cc 由于B表的cc远多于一个表的cc所以这样做很浪费时间
,
总结:用在时大表在前小表在后,
,,,,,,,用存在时小表在前大表在后


2。


,,,

sql的出口函数